    Feras Alhlou is a seasoned entrepreneur and business leader with a track record of building and selling companies. He co-founded and chairs e-CENS, offering digital transformation services, leveraging over 20 years of startup experience. 

    Feras is a highly accomplished entrepreneur known for building multi-million-dollar businesses. In North America, he founded e-Nor, which became a premier Google Analytics certified partner, eventually acquired by dentsu in 2019. In his latest endeavor, Start Up With Feras, he provides expert guidance to founders and executives on growth strategies, sales scaling, and fostering strong organizational cultures. Feras, a co-author of "Google Analytics Breakthrough," holds a Masters in Engineering Management. Feras mentors founders on business strategy, marketing, and more. He's active in nonprofit work, notably with the American Red Cross, and is passionate about bridging income gaps and mentoring youth. A practitioner of Aikido, he values resolving conflicts harmoniously. Feras shares startup insights through educational resources and videos, embodying a commitment to helping founders succeed and supporting charitable endeavors.

    Josefine Campbell Power Barometer

    Josefine Campbell Power Barometer

    Power Barometer -  How to manage personal energy for business success with Josefine Campbell

    In the corporate world, the minds of employees are a company's greatest asset, yet often overlooked is the finite nature of personal energy. In today's fast-paced environment, adaptability and resilience are essential. However, stress, anxiety, and disengagement plague modern workplaces, taking a toll on mental well-being.

    Join us as leadership coach and jiu jitsu champion, Josefine Campbell, explores strategies to boost awareness and navigate the fluctuating states of mind—be it agile, mellow, narrow, or fragile. Drawing from her extensive experience coaching executives at multinational giants like McDonald's and Deloitte, and her martial arts training, Josefine introduces the Awareness Matrix, a roadmap to success.

    Packed with real-world case studies and actionable tools, her book POWER BAROMETER: How to Manage Personal Energy for Business Success offers insights on enhancing personal energy, fostering mental agility, and boosting productivity in both individual and team settings.
